The German Record Critics' Award is one of the most respected institutions in the European musical landscape. Founded in 1963, the PdSK brings together music critics and journalists from Germany, Austria, and Switzerland who evaluate new record releases in every musical genre with rigorous independence.
The association, which includes up to 160 jurors divided into 32 specialized juries, covers the entire spectrum of musical production: from symphonic music to opera, from jazz to folklore, from metal to hip-hop. The quarterly selection process ensures that only productions of excellence receive this coveted recognition.

The "Missa l'homme armé super voces musicales" is considered one of the most emblematic works of Josquin Desprez (1450-1521), the undisputed master of Renaissance polyphony. This work represents a perfect example of his extraordinary ability to weave complex vocal lines into a harmonious and profound ensemble. The mastery with which Desprez combines compositional technique and deep emotional expressiveness has influenced generations of subsequent composers, making this work a landmark in the history of Western music.
